The cost of living difference between Camp Point, IL and Germantown Hills, IL is dramatic. Camp Point is 31.2% cheaper than Germantown Hills,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Camp Point has a cost index of 64 while Germantown Hills sits at 93,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.

When it comes to buying, median home values in Camp Point are $111,700 compared to $265,300 in Germantown Hills, a 58% gap.

Median household income in Camp Point is $58,438 compared to $141,719 in Germantown Hills (-58.8%). While Germantown Hills is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income.
